Patricia Tate Whiting McCleary (née Barron), often called Patti (later spelled Patty) Tate, is a fictional character on the now-cancelled American soap opera Search for Tomorrow. She was played by numerous actresses over the years, including Tina Sloan and Jacqueline Schultz (who played her at the show's end), but actresses Lynn Loring and Leigh Lassen are perhaps most identified with the role.

Patti was the daughter of Joanne Gardner and her first husband, Keith Barron (John Sylvester White). After Keith had died in a car accident, Jo began to make a home for herself, knowing that she had a young daughter to raise. Patti had been a target of Keith's mother, Irene Barron, who tried to sue Jo for custody, but failed, and then tried to kidnap her.

She had a best friend in Janet Bergman, her next door neighbor, and the daughter of Stu and Marge Bergman.

When Jo married her second husband, Arthur Tate, he adopted Patti, giving her his last name. She had met and fallen in love with Dr. Len Whiting, a very weak man, who was a doctor, and she was hated by his mother, Andrea Whiting (Joan Copeland). However, Andrea had hidden from Len that he was the son of Sam Reynolds, who, by this time, was seeing Patti's mother, Jo. (Arthur having died of a heart attack) Andrea was hateful due to the heavy guilt she had over the death of Len's twin brother.

Patti continued to work as a nurse at Henderson Hospital, and when she went through a difficult pregnancy after giving birth to Sarah. Patti also had two other children (Possibly via Len or someone else), Chris and Tracey, although their history with Patti & Jo were totally ignored by the powers that be for Search For Tomorrow.

Later, she was to work with an assigned nurse named, Stephanie Wilkins, who would later on become her mother's adversary. After Len had committed a crime, he and Patti left for Seattle in 1978 and so did his mother, Andrea, now more caring and sympathetic.
